这是我从1月6日开始主持天极网论坛嵌入式开发版以来第一次发表文章,加上以前琐碎的文章共计30篇。研究的越多就越感觉自己懂的太少,其实在驱动开发方面我还是个菜鸟,我是想再次抛砖引玉,让做驱动有N年经验的人奉献一点出来,让大家减少一些研究驱动源码而又缺少注释所带来的痛苦。
开发人员使用 Windows Embedded CE 来开发各种智能、互联、服务导向设备,这些设备范围广泛,包括从低功耗的 GPS 手持设备到实时的任务关键性工业控制器在内的一系列设备。通过 Windows Embedded CE 6.0 R2 更新,多种新组件帮助 Windows Embedded CE 6.0 设备制造商有效地开发组件化、内存占用量小、连接到 Windows Vista 和 Windows Server 2008 的设备。
熟悉WIN32编程的人一定知道,WIN32的进程管理方式与Linux上有着很大区别,在Unix里,只有进程的概念,但在WIN32里却还有一个"线程"的概念,那么Linux和WIN32在这里究竟有着什么区别呢?
IT部门应公司领导要求,或者自己管理方便,总是想尽办法让你拥有尽量少的权限。光驱,软驱就别想用了;BIOS密码是不会告诉你的(当然大多数情况下,这个不是问题);C盘一定是NTFS格式的,boot.ini你就别去碰了,没有希望的,C盘有没有写的权限还需要看IT部同事们的心情呢;封USB一般分两种:物理端口贴封条,那叫人治,系统设置卡权限叫法制,相对来说前者比较阴险;用域控制器统一管理权限;还会用各种组策略卡你各种应用程序执行权限。
通过对嵌入式GUI软件Microwindows进行分析并与X window进行对比,阐述Microwindows用于嵌入式设备上的优点;简要论述Microwindows的体系结构和图形应用程序接口;介绍其设备驱动特性、API、客户机/服务器模型、画图机制和FLTK。
本短信网关系统由PC机和WiFi智能手机组成,PC机与WiFi智能手机之间通过自定义的通信协议进行数据通信。
针对高温微波烧结设备对可靠性、稳定性和多功能的需求,提出了一种基于Windows CE的大功率微波嵌入式控制系统,实现了对高温微波烧结设备可靠、精确的控制。不但丰富了系统功能,提高了控制精度,而且使复杂的操作简单化。
Windows CE操作系统存在启动速度慢的现象。为此在解析系统镜像文件和研究镜像文件下载函数的基础上,设计了一种在Windows CE系统Bootloader中实现Multi-bin的方法。通过调用Bootloader中的BootPart支持库的接口函数,借助BinFS文件系统,从而减少了系统的启动时延,增加了用户的可用内存,降低了客户的等待时间,最终达到提高客户用户体验(QoE)的目的。
介绍了Windows CE 的体系结构和中断处理机制, 研究了Windows CE 设备驱动程序的类型和初始化过程,以维信诺VGG13264C 132×64 OLED 显示模块的WindowsCE 驱动程序设计为例, 详细阐述了嵌入式Windows CE 驱动程序的开发过程。
ARM版Windows 8(WOA)不支持Windows 7:Windows 8能够在老版Windows 7 PC上运行,因为x86平台已基本实现标准化,而ARM则不然。辛诺夫斯基表示:“ARM公司许可的是ARM产品设计,但没有实现标准化。”如果用户希望运行现有x86软件,就需要一款x86设备。
从6月20号的Windows Phone开发者峰会的首次亮相,到前不久SDK的流出,有关微软下一代移动操作系统Windows Phone 8的更多详情浮出水面。日前,知名科技媒体The V
体域网包含一系列传感器节点,通过短距离通信技术实现与外界的通信,提供医疗保健、消费电子、个人娱乐等多项服务。论述了一个结合体域网,利用微软公司推出的XNA技术和.NET框架,在Windows Phone 7环境下设计实现的体感健身系统。
在Windows CE下GPIO是端口扩展器,当微控制器缺乏足够的I/O端口时,GPIO能够提供额外的控制和监视功能。本文分析了基于流驱动的GPIO驱动开发原理,以SC36410的GPM端口为例详细叙述了GPIO驱动开发过程,并给出了驱动程序的配置方法。
采用Lab Windows/CVI虚拟仪器技术构建检测系统平台,介绍了基于PXI总线的某装备通用检测系统设计。对通用检测系统的硬件组成和软件设计进行了详细的说明 概述 随着开发生产的
微软已经成为开源世界的大力支持者,除了购买 GitHub 之外,该公司还继续让 Linux 在 Windows 中运行,并在微软商店为 Windows 10 用户提供更多选择。正如您已经知道的那样,有几个 Linux 发行版可以在 Microsoft Store 中下载,其中包括桌面用户数量最多的 Canonical Ubuntu。
微软Surface家族设备将迎来爆发,此前微软抢先发布的Surface Hub 2可能是一个明显的征兆,在进入全新的Surface“第二代”时刻,微软将在软硬件上革新,引入Windows 10 CShell概念。现在Surface Pro 6(也就是Surface Pro新款)被曝将于2019年中期发布。
现在已知联想正和仁宝研发的ELZE1设备,惠普和广达合作的Chimera2都有望搭载高通骁龙850进入市场。而戴尔代号为Januss以及微软代号为Andromeda的设备也在路上,他们很有可能是搭载Windows 10的双屏可折叠设备。
在工业控制中,常需要将单片机采集到的数据传送给PC机处理、显示,并且根据处理结果给单片机发送控制命令。串行通信虽然传送速度相对较慢,但是传送成本低,对实现监视和控制,具有足够的带宽,并且没有
在微软打开Linux进入Windows 10的大门后,我们看到了大量的Linux发行版已经上架Windows商店。
Windows 10 on ARM为高通公司提供了一个机会,不仅可以在移动处理器领域统治,还想在桌面领域把Intel拉下马。根据Winfuture.de的最新报告,高通正在打造Windows ARM系统的专属处理器骁龙850。